Quick Ham & Bean Salad Recipe

Looking for a good side salad to take to the next BBQ or family gathering? This Easy Ham and Bean Salad is quick to put together and can be made a day or two ahead. It incorporates a few fresh vegetables with canned beans with a great sweet and sour dressing. The ham makes it suitable for a light main dish salad, but it’s also great with grilled meats or poultry as well as other picnic dishes.

8 Servings


Dressing
1/4 cup vegetable oil
1/2 cup sugar
2 tablespoons apple cider vinegar
1 clove garlic, finely minced
1/2 teaspoon salt
1/2 teaspoon freshly ground black pepper
1/2 teaspoon Tabasco pepper sauce, or other hot sauce

1 15 oz. can black beans, drained and rinsed
1 15 oz. can pinto beans, drained and rinsed
1/2 cup green bell peppers, diced
1/2 red bell pepper, diced
1/2 cup chopped celery
3 chopped green onions including tops
1 cup lean ham , diced
  1. Mix the vegetable oil, sugar, vinegar, garlic, salt, pepper, and Tabasco in a blender container and blend until the sugar is dissolved. Scrape down the sides and blend again. Alternately, whisk together the dressing ingredients in a small bowl; set the dressing aside.

  2. Mix the beans, bell peppers, celery, onions, and ham in a small bowl.

  3. Pour the dressing over and mix well.

  4. Cover with plastic wrap and refrigerate at least 4 hours or overnight.
